The choice of mobility scooter frequently depends on the features that line up with private needs. Here are a few of the crucial features to consider:
Weight Capacity: Mobility scooters come with various weight limitations. It is important to pick a scooter that can sufficiently support the user's weight.
Range: The range a scooter can travel on a single charge varies. Depending upon user needs, one might go with scooters with a variety of approximately 40 miles.
Speed: Most mobility scooters can reach speeds in between 4 to 8 miles per hour. Consider what speed is comfortable and safe for the desired environment.
Turning Radius: A compact turning radius is essential for indoor usage, permitting for much easier navigation in tight spaces.
Battery Type: The kind of batteries used can impact the scooter's efficiency. Lead-acid and lithium-ion batteries are the most typical.
Benefits of Using Mobility Scooters
The benefits of mobility scooters extend beyond just transportation. Some key advantages include:
Independence: Users can navigate their environment without counting on caregivers, promoting self-reliance and confidence.
Health Benefits: Using a scooter can encourage outside activity, causing physical and psychological health improvements by lowering sensations of seclusion.
Convenience: Scooters can quickly be operated in numerous environments, whether inside your home, in mall, or outdoors.
Essential Considerations When Buying a Mobility Scooter
When acquiring a mobility scooter, a number of factors to consider can help guarantee that you choose the right model:
Assess Individual Needs:
Mobility level: Consider how much assistance the person will need.Series of usage: Determine where the scooter will mainly be utilized (indoors, outdoors, on rough surfaces, etc).
Test Drive:
Always test drive numerous models to find an ideal fit. Pay attention to comfort, ease of steering, and the scooter's responsiveness.
Evaluation Safety Features:
Look for scooters with appropriate security functions like lights, signs, and anti-tip styles.
Examine Warranty and Service Options:
A reliable guarantee and available service options are important for long-term usage.Frequently Asked Questions about Mobility Scooters
1. How fast do mobility scooters go?Mobility scooters usually have speeds varying from 4 to 8 mph, with many created for security instead of high-speed travel. 2. Are there weight limitations on mobility scooters?Yes, mobility
scooters feature particular weight limits, often ranging from
250 lbs to over 500 pounds, depending upon the model. 3. Can mobility scooters be used indoors?Certain models, especially compact scooters, are specifically designed for
indoor usage and are much easier to steer in tight areas. 4. How typically do the batteries require to be replaced?Battery life can vary based on use, but generally, with appropriate care, batteries may last between 1 to 3 years before requiring replacement
. 5. Are mobility scooters covered by insurance?Coverage can differ, however some insurance coverage strategies, including Medicare and Medicaid, may cover part of the cost. It's suggested to talk to individual insurance coverage providers. Mobility scooters work as a
